YouTube Full Channel,Playlists,Shorts,Live...

YouTube Full Channel,Playlists,Shorts,Live...

by dz_omar

Extract metadata, scripts, and smart keywords from any YouTube content—channels, playlists, Shorts, and live streams. Perfect for SEO research and competitive analysis.

9,439 runs
128 users
Try This Actor

Opens on Apify.com

About YouTube Full Channel,Playlists,Shorts,Live...

Need to pull data from a YouTube channel, but dreading the manual work? I've been there. This actor is my go-to for extracting clean, structured metadata from any YouTube content. It doesn't just get the basics; it intelligently parses out the smart keywords that actually matter, like trending #hashtags and linked @channelnames, which is gold for analysis. You can point it at entire channels, specific playlists, Shorts, live streams, podcasts, or even courses. I often use it for batch requests to compare multiple channels at once. The output gives you everything from titles and descriptions to scripts and engagement stats in a ready-to-use format. For SEO work, it helps you reverse-engineer what's working for competitors. For content research, it reveals the common themes and keywords hidden in video transcripts. It saves hours of copying and pasting, letting you focus on the insights instead of the data collection.

What does this actor do?

YouTube Full Channel,Playlists,Shorts,Live... is a web scraping and automation tool available on the Apify platform. It's designed to help you extract data and automate tasks efficiently in the cloud.

Key Features

  • Cloud-based execution - no local setup required
  • Scalable infrastructure for large-scale operations
  • API access for integration with your applications
  • Built-in proxy rotation and anti-blocking measures
  • Scheduled runs and webhooks for automation

How to Use

  1. Click "Try This Actor" to open it on Apify
  2. Create a free Apify account if you don't have one
  3. Configure the input parameters as needed
  4. Run the actor and download your results

Documentation

YouTube Scraper Pro Actor

Extracts structured data from YouTube videos, shorts, live streams, channels, playlists, and courses. It also processes keyword patterns like #hashtag and @channelname. The actor is designed for reliability, with state preservation to resume from interruptions.

Actor Link: YouTube Scraper Pro
Categories: VIDEOS, SEO_TOOLS

Overview

This Apify actor scrapes publicly available metadata and transcripts from YouTube. It automatically detects the content type from a URL (e.g., video, channel, playlist) and extracts comprehensive data. Output is provided in structured formats like JSON and CSV for analysis.

Key Features

  • Broad Content Support: Handles videos, Shorts, live streams, podcasts, courses, channels, and playlists.
  • Smart Input Recognition: Automatically detects content type from URLs. Also accepts #hashtag and @channelname patterns.
  • Comprehensive Data Extraction: Fetches titles, descriptions, views, upload dates, thumbnails, and more.
  • Transcript Download: Retrieves available transcripts in SRT, VTT, TXT, and XML formats.
  • Resilient Operation: Built-in state preservation prevents progress loss on migration or failure.
  • Performance Controls: Configurable request delays and concurrency to manage speed and avoid rate limits.
  • Proxy Support: Designed to work with proxies for sustained, large-scale scraping.

How to Use

  1. Provide Input: Supply one or more YouTube URLs or keyword patterns in the actor's input configuration.
  2. Configure (Optional): Adjust settings like maxResults, processing speed, or transcript format.
  3. Run: Execute the actor. It will process the URLs, extract data, and handle pagination for channels/playlists automatically.
  4. Get Output: Download the results from the dataset as JSON, CSV, or other formats.

Input Configuration

The primary input is the rawYouTubeUrls array. Basic usage:

{
  "rawYouTubeUrls": [
    "https://www.youtube.com/@nesoacademy/shorts",
    "https://www.youtube.com/watch?v=qUdSpbimHDQ",
    "#tutorial"
  ],
  "maxResults": 50
}

Common Input Parameters:

  • rawYouTubeUrls: (Required) Array of YouTube URLs or patterns (@channel, #hashtag).
  • maxResults: Maximum number of items to return per channel/playlist.
  • languageCode: Preferred language for transcripts (e.g., "en").
  • shouldGetTranscripts: Set to true to download subtitle files.
  • maxConcurrency & delay: Control request speed to be respectful to YouTube's servers.

Output

The actor outputs a dataset where each item represents a video or content entry. Typical fields include:

{
  "id": "qUdSpbimHDQ",
  "url": "https://www.youtube.com/watch?v=qUdSpbimHDQ",
  "title": "Example Video Title",
  "channelTitle": "Example Channel",
  "viewCount": "123456",
  "uploadDate": "2023-10-05",
  "description": "Full video description...",
  "thumbnailUrl": "https://...jpg",
  "transcriptText": "Full transcript text if requested...",
  "transcriptSrt": "[APIFY DATASET FILE ATTACHMENT LINK]"
}

Results can be downloaded via the Apify console or accessed via API in JSON, CSV, HTML, or other formats.

Compliance Notes

  • This tool only extracts publicly accessible data.
  • Users must comply with YouTube's Terms of Service.
  • Use proxies and rate limiting to distribute request load.
  • You are responsible for ensuring your use case complies with applicable laws.

Common Use Cases

Market Research

Gather competitive intelligence and market data

Lead Generation

Extract contact information for sales outreach

Price Monitoring

Track competitor pricing and product changes

Content Aggregation

Collect and organize content from multiple sources

Ready to Get Started?

Try YouTube Full Channel,Playlists,Shorts,Live... now on Apify. Free tier available with no credit card required.

Start Free Trial

Actor Information

Developer
dz_omar
Pricing
Paid
Total Runs
9,439
Active Users
128
Apify Platform

Apify provides a cloud platform for web scraping, data extraction, and automation. Build and run web scrapers in the cloud.

Learn more about Apify

Need Professional Help?

Couldn't solve your problem? Hire a verified specialist on Fiverr to get it done quickly and professionally.

Find a Specialist

Trusted by millions | Money-back guarantee | 24/7 Support